Who We Care For

As a primary care practice, we care for nearly everyone.

We see patients 13 years and up, and we have some groups of folks that Wren tends to work more frequently with. Below are some common people we see in clinic or common conditions we help people manage.

Hepatitis C & HIV Management

Wren has completed additional education through the American Academy of HIV Medicine (AAHIVM) in order to obtain a specialist certification. They treat hepatitis C and manage HIV in the primary care setting when appropriate.

Substance Use

Wren has completed additional training through Providers Clinical Support System (PCSS) for management of alcohol use disorder, methamphetamine use, and opioid use. Wren prescribes medications for opioid use disorders (MOUD).

Ehlers-Danlos Syndrome

EDS, hyper mobile spectrum disorder (HSD) and their common associated symptoms and conditions (MCAS, POTS, dysautonomia, histamine intolerance, etc)

Hormone Therapy for Trans Folks

Wren has completed significant training and mentorship through the World Professional Association for Transgender Health (WPATH), and they believe gender-affirming care is primary care.

Neurodivergent Folks

ADHD and autism support, affirming referrals, management of common co-occurring conditions, and medication management.

Queer Folks

Wren has completed additional education through The National LGBTQIA+ Health Education Center. They work to provide culturally competent care for all patients who have felt underrepresented in medical spaces.
